AI pilots launched in Barnsley in blueprint for 'Tech Towns'
New AI pilot programmes launched in Barnsley could serve as a blueprint for modern “Tech Towns” as the government aims to spread digital skills across the country. Last month the South Yorkshire town was named as the UK’s first Tech Town, a new designation from the government that signals targeted support to rollout new technologies and increase skills. Barnsley tests AI in healthcare and everyday work
Barnsley is launching two pilot schemes to bring artificial intelligence into daily life, with a focus on healthcare services and local businesses. At Barnsley Hospital NHS Foundation Trust, AI tools will be introduced to reduce waiting times, cut missed appointments and ease administrative pressure on staff.
